如何从跨度获取数据并使用javaScript将其传输到另一个跨度

时间:2014-10-12 22:51:58

标签: javascript html ajax jsp

这是我的简单代码,但它不适用于我

<%@ page language="java" contentType="text/html; charset=windows-1256"
        pageEncoding="windows-1256"%>
    <!DOCTYPE html>
    <html lang="en">
        <head>
            <title></title>
            <script type="text/javascript">
                function getdata() {

                    var s =document.getElementById("src").value;

                    document.getElementById("trg").innerHTML=s;
                }
            </script>
        </head>
        <body>
            <span id="src"> source</span><p />
            <input type="button" value="ok" onclick="getdata()"> <p />
            <span id="trg">Empty</span>
        </body>
    </html>

当我点击按钮(ok)时,我想将span(id =“src”)的值传递给span(id =“trg”)。有人可以帮我吗?!

1 个答案:

答案 0 :(得分:1)

span元素没有值,要从span src获取内容,请使用:

var s = document.getElementById("src").innerHTML